Limitations of Spatial Judgment Bias Test Application in Horses (<i>Equus ferus caballus</i>)
Affective states are of increasing interest in the assessment of animal welfare. This research aimed to evaluate the possible limitations in the application of a spatial judgment bias test (JBT) in horses, considering the influence of stress level, personality traits, and the possible bias due to th...
